Judith C. Kelleher Award for Contributions to Emergency Nursing

This award, named after one of ENA’s co-founders, honors a member of ENA who has consistently demonstrated excellence in emergency nursing and has made significant contributions to the profession and to ENA. The award is presented at the Anita Dorr luncheon during ENA’s annual conference.

Nycole Oliver, DNP, MBA, MSN, APRN, RN, FNP-C, ACNPC-AG, ENP-C, CEN, FAEN

Nycole Oliver is an advanced practice registered nurse with Baptist Health – Fort Smith, where she has devoted most of her career to using her advanced education toward improving care practices, leading professional development for other nurses and meeting every challenge as an opportunity.

She has shared her expertise in education and clinical standards far beyond the hospital where she has worked for more than 25 years. She has given more than 75 professional presentations at the local, state, regional, national and international levels.

Her involvement in ENA began with taking TNCC and ultimately bringing it to her hospital. Her contributions to the association over the years are far-reaching, including her current role as a member of the ENA Foundation Board of Trustees. Oliver has volunteered committees such as the ENA Advanced Practice Advisory Council, the Resolutions Committee and the Conference Education Planning Committee. Her work at the state level included time as Arkansas ENA Council president and on numerous committees. She was inducted into the Academy of Emergency Nursing in 2020.
